Wolf Alice: Status and Significance in Alternative Rock

Introduction: Why Wolf Alice matters
Wolf Alice is a British alternative rock band whose blend of grunge, shoegaze and indie-pop has attracted international attention since the early 2010s. The group’s music and critical recognition, including a Mercury Prize, have made them a recurring reference point in contemporary guitar-based music. For readers tracking shifts in alternative scenes, Wolf Alice’s trajectory illustrates how a band can move from underground beginnings to mainstream acclaim while retaining a distinct artistic voice.
Main body: Background, milestones and musical identity
Formed in London in 2010, Wolf Alice began as a small project and grew into a four-piece band. Fronted by vocalist and guitarist Ellie Rowsell, the group also includes guitarist Joff Oddie, bassist Theo Ellis and drummer Joel Amey. Over the past decade the band has developed a reputation for dynamic live performances and a sonic range that covers intimate balladry, loud rock anthems and textured, atmospheric songs.
The band’s recorded output helped establish their place in the UK and international alternative scenes. Their debut studio album, My Love Is Cool (2015), brought wider attention and set the stage for subsequent releases. Wolf Alice’s follow-up, Visions of a Life (2017), received strong critical praise and earned the band the 2018 Mercury Prize, a notable recognition in the British music industry. Their 2021 album Blue Weekend further reinforced their profile with mature songwriting and continued critical interest.
Wolf Alice’s music is often noted for its contrasts: abrasive and soft textures, confessional lyrics alongside expansive arrangements. This versatility has allowed the band to appeal to diverse audiences and to perform across a range of venues and festivals. Critics and listeners frequently highlight Ellie Rowsell’s distinctive voice and the group’s ability to shift between moods without losing cohesion.
